reference

Eine Referenz ist ein Wert, der es einem Programm ermöglicht, indirekt auf ein bestimmtes Datum wie eine Variable oder einen Datensatz im Computerspeicher oder in einem anderen Speichergerät zuzugreifen.
3
Antworten

STL-Map mit Referenzen wird nicht kompiliert

Folgendes: %Vor% gibt: %Vor% Während der folgenden %Vor% gibt %Vor% Letzteres scheint so zu sein, dass map keine Referenz für den Schlüsselwert enthalten kann, da sie die Klasse manchmal instanziieren muss und eine Referenz ohne...
29.05.2010, 06:04
3
Antworten

Übergabe der Referenzoptionen in C ++

Ich möchte ein Objekt der Klasse A (nennen wir es a) durch Verweis (im weiten Sinn, dh entweder durch A & amp; oder durch A *) an den Konstruktor einer anderen Klasse B übergeben. Ich will kein 'a' innerhalb von B geändert werden ('a' ist nur le...
29.10.2015, 18:35
3
Antworten

Ein VS2010 Bug? Erlauben verbindliche nicht-const Referenz auf Rvalue OHNE EINE Warnung?

%Vor% GCC ist der beste, um einen Kompilierungsfehler zu erhalten: ungültige Initialisierung von nichtkonstanten Referenzen vom Typ std::string& von einem temporären Typ std::string VS2008 ist nicht so schlecht, zumindest gibt es...
25.08.2011, 11:16
4
Antworten

Warum ist * & x nicht dasselbe wie x?

Kurzversion: Der folgende Code kompiliert nicht: %Vor% aber das tut: %Vor% Warum? Vollständiger Code: %Vor% GetMenuString Signatur (aus atluser.h , aus WTL): %Vor%     
08.10.2011, 20:29
3
Antworten

const verweist auf ein nicht-konstantes Objekt

Würde im Folgenden ein temporäres Objekt erstellt werden, bevor const Referenz auf ein nicht-konstantes Objekt verwendet wird? %Vor% Wenn nein, wie funktioniert das? %Vor%     
13.09.2011, 18:55
4
Antworten

C ++ - Typ stimmt nicht überein: const Foo * to Foo * const &

Diese Menge von Objekten und Anweisungen: %Vor% Ich bekomme den Fehler "keine bekannte Konvertierung für Argument 1 von 'const Foo *' nach 'Foo * const & amp;". Ich schätze, ich habe Schwierigkeiten, diese Typen zu lesen, weil ich keine Ahnu...
05.05.2015, 02:02
7
Antworten

Differenz des Funktionsarguments als (const int &) und (int & a) in C ++

Ich weiß, wenn Sie void function_name (int & amp; a) schreiben, dann wird die Funktion keine lokale Kopie Ihrer als Argument übergebenen Variable ausführen. Auch in der Literatur haben Sie festgestellt, dass Sie void function_name (const int & a...
28.04.2010, 07:03
4
Antworten

Warum unterstützt die Funktion call_user_func () von PHP nicht die Übergabe als Referenz?

Warum unterstützt die Funktion, die Funktionen wie call_user_func() unterstützt, die Parameter nicht als Referenz? Die Dokumente sagen knappe Dinge wie "Beachten Sie, dass die Parameter für call_user_func () nicht als Referenz übergeben...
07.06.2011, 01:10
1
Antwort

Warum wird der Destruktor der abgeleiteten Klasse bei einer const-Referenz auf die Basisklasse aufgerufen?

In GMans Antwort hier , der Destruktor der Klasse restore_base ist nicht virtual , also frage ich mich, wie genau das funktioniert. Normalerweise würde man erwarten, dass der Destruktor von restorer_base nur ausgeführt wird, nachdem das...
13.02.2011, 17:49
2
Antworten

Ist es möglich, in strings.xml auf eine andere Zeichenfolge zu verweisen? [Duplikat]

Ist es möglich, eine Zeichenfolge in strings.xml in einer anderen Zeichenfolge zu referenzieren, die anderen Text enthält? Etwas, das in XML erlaubt ist und diesen Effekt erreichen würde: %Vor%     
03.05.2010, 10:55